Transaction
883564677766a3a4ab4f57bb7ae0f42fd3ae4eccc6ee3d5972ecf129474ad21f

Block
Time
5/29/2021 7:17:48 PM
Version
2
Size
103 B
Confirmations
1826189

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
30 VEIL